 DUTIES:

The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A), National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S), Office of International Affairs, Trade, and Commerce (IATC) has a statutory responsibility to manage marine fisheries and resources in accordance with the Magnuson-Stevens Fishery Conservation and Management Act (MSA) and other relevant Federal laws such as the, the Marine Mammal Protection Act, the Endangered Species Act, the High Seas Driftnet Fishing Moratorium Protection Act (Moratorium Protection Act), and the Maritime Security and Fisheries Enforcement Act (Maritime SAFE Act) to address illegal, unreported, and unregulated (IUU) fishing and other unsustainable fisheries practices by foreign nations that compete with U.S. fisheries and seafood products.  NMFS IATC engages other countries bilaterally and through regional fisheries management organizations (RFMOs) and other multilateral organizations to promote sound management, conservation, and sustainability of living marine resources.  

OIA seeks a Senior Data Analyst to provide trade data analysis support to IATC’s Seafood Import Monitoring Program (SIMP), which includes the following activities: 

  • Collect, categorize, analyze, and interpret data from complex and diverse data sets.
  • Assist in risk assessments with both quantitative and qualitative information.
  • Guide analysis with data-poor sets. 
  • Support SIMP economic assessments, including providing guidance on analysis and overseeing the development of project deliverables. 
  • Develop data visualizations and written materials to interpret complex analyses into plain language.
